Description-en: Data mining algorithm development framework - development files
ELKI: "Environment for Developing KDD-Applications Supported by
Index-Structures" is a development framework for data mining algorithms
written in Java. It includes a large variety of popular data mining
algorithms, distance functions and index structures.
.
Its focus is particularly on clustering and outlier detection methods, in
contrast to many other data mining toolkits that focus on classification.
Additionally, it includes support for index structures to improve algorithm
performance such as R*-Tree and M-Tree.
.
The modular architecture is meant to allow adding custom components such
as distance functions or algorithms, while being able to reuse the other
parts for evaluation.
.
This package contains the JavaDoc and the source code package.
